General Patches strategy on 7×7: rectangles cannot overlap, every cell must belong to exactly one patch, and each patch must contain precisely one clue at its anchor cell. When a clue shows area 12 and a tall icon, only a few height×width pairs are legal — list them before drawing. After each placement, mentally partition the leftover white space: if any region cannot host its remaining clues, back up and try the next candidate.
